IMMORTALS Movie Reviews
Story: Action fantasy about the battle for the future of humanity between bloodthirsty King Hyperion and the stonemason Theseus. Cast: Henry Cavill, Mickey Rourke, Stephen Dorff, Freida Pinto Director: Tarsem Singh Opened: November 11, 2011 On DVD: March 6, 2012 From: Relativity Media Rating: R Length: 1 hr. 50 min.

Immortals played to fair reviews. • Sheila Johnston wrote in the Boston Phoenix, "...its main appeal may be to those who enjoy slo-mo exploding heads in 3D." • And Rick Bentley wrote in the Seattle Times, "...a one-note story that never resonates either on a personal or heroic level. There might have been some leeway if the casting, direction and costuming weren't so ludicrous."   More Reviews Below...

BROAD NATIONAL PRESS (6 Reviews)
Richard Corliss, Time: WEAK
"The pity is that Tarsem Singh's intelligence doesn't connect his cinematic eye to his narrative mind. The director's visual gift is like a brilliant retina, detached." (Read the full review...)
1,045 words, 11/11/11

Adam Markovitz, Entertainment Weekly: VERY GOOD (cg)
"Director Tarsem Singh has no apparent love or patience for storytelling, but he is a visualist on par with Julie Taymor and Tim Burton." (Read the full review...)
362 words, 11/14/11

Scott Bowles, USA Today: MODERATE (cg)
"...a cut above the wretched 'Clash of the Titans' remake but can't quite replicate the visuals of '300' or the sweep of 'The Lord of the Rings'..." (Read the full review...)
212 words, 11/11/11

Roger Ebert, RogerEbert.com: WEAK (cg)
"...without doubt the best-looking awful movie you will ever see." (Read the full review...)
803 words, 11/11/11

Kat Murphy, MSN Movies: WEAK (cg)
"Almost every shot gobsmacks the eye, but its impact stands alone, never carrying over to the next image, accumulating narrative momentum and meaning." (Read the full review...)
786 words, 11/11/11

James Berardinelli, Reel Views: VERY GOOD (cg)
"...plays like the illegitimate offspring of '300' and 'Clash of the Titans'... while it represents a substantial improvement over the latter, it falls short of the former." (Read the full review...)

NEW YORK/LOS ANGELES/CHICAGO/TORONTO (11 Reviews)
Paul Brunick, New York Times: POOR
"This jumbled epic of absurd coincidences and logical gaps can barely track its internal mythology.... an ugly, burlap sack of a film..." (Read the full review...)
275 words, 11/11/11

Elizabeth Weitzman, New York Daily News: GOOD (NOT GREAT) (cg)
"...pulpy fun that feels utterly ludicrous whenever it hints at more solemn aspirations. But that's okay. A popcorn movie has one goal, and that's to entertain." (Read the full review...)
331 words, 11/11/11

Betsy Sharkey, Los Angeles Times: FAIR
"All the unimaginable ways to inflict a world of hurt are imagined here in frightful images... What's missing is the emotion that might have lifted the film and us as well." (Read the full review...)
800 words, 11/11/11

Kyle Smith, New York Post: MODERATE (cg)
"Spectacularly silly? Yes, but at least it's spectacular." (Read the full review...)
717 words, 11/11/11

John Anderson, New York Newsday: WEAK (cg)
"Overly computerized hooey with a sadistic streak." (Read the full review...)
307 words, 11/11/11

Bilge Ebiri, New York Magazine: MODERATE
"...veers between the genuinely striking and the strikingly generic." (Read the full review...)
636 words, 11/12/11

Roger Ebert, Chicago Sun-Times: WEAK (cg)
"...without doubt the best-looking awful movie you will ever see." (Read the full review...)
803 words, 11/11/11

Nick Pinkerton, Village Voice: MODERATE
"...has little on its mind but conveying the buzz of martial glory.... this is among the most extravagantly violent movies in memory..." (Read the full review...)
229 words, 11/16/11

Linda Barnard, Toronto Star: WEAK (cg)
"...emphasizes heroics and bone-crunching violence in 3-D, with a splash of sexy time to lighten the mood and detract from the flaccid script." (Read the full review...)
635 words, 11/11/11

Rick Groen, Toronto Globe & Mail: GOOD (NOT GREAT) (cg)
"...fairly efficient in its operation, typically clean in look, and guaranteed to reach its destination with a minimum of fuss. Thrills are in short supply, but so are annoyances." (Read the full review...)
634 words, 11/11/11

Radheyan Simonpillai, Toronto Now: WEAK (cg)
"...a film riddled with pompous speeches and characters as colourless and stiff as Greek statues. A little humour could have gone a long way." (Read the full review...)
185 words, 11/11/11
KEY CITIES (5 Reviews)
Mark Jenkins, Washington Post: WEAK (cg)
"With its images modeled on Renaissance paintings, 'Immortals' looks shadowy and solemn, but its script is sometimes garbled and frequently silly." (Read the full review...)
409 words, 11/11/11

Roger Moore, Orlando Sentinel: WEAK (cg)
"Grisly, gross, messy... a pseudo-arty melding of spatter film to the sword-and-sorcery genre." (Read the full review...)
511 words, 11/11/11

Ty Burr, Boston Globe: MODERATE (cg)
"...simply the latest video game disguised as a film, and cut-rate post-production 3-D hardly helps. Just goofy enough to be more than a waste of time..." (Read the full review...)
495 words, 11/12/11

Stephen Whitty, New Jersey Star-Ledger: MODERATE (cg)
"...if you want another dose of '300' -- but with more sadism this time, and a dash of ersatz Hieronymous Bosch -- then 'Immortals' is the film for you." (Read the full review...)
537 words, 11/11/11

Rick Bentley, Seattle Times: POOR (cg)
"...a one-note story that never resonates either on a personal or heroic level. There might have been some leeway if the casting, direction and costuming weren't so ludicrous." (Read the full review...)
